Made byBobr AI

Windows: Architektur, Historie & Softwareentwicklung

Detaillierte Analyse von Microsoft Windows: Von NT-Architektur und Kernel-Modus bis hin zu WSL, Lizenzierung und Marktanteilen für Fachinformatiker.

#windows#betriebssysteme#softwareentwicklung#informatik-studium#kernel-architektur#wsl2#it-infrastruktur#microsoft
abstract modern technology background blue and white minimalist geometric shapes

Microsoft Windows

Historie, Architektur, Marktverbreitung und Bedeutung für die Anwendungsentwicklung

Fachinformatiker Anwendungsentwicklung | Schuljahr 2025/2026

Made byBobr AI

Agenda

  • Historie und Entwicklungslinien
  • Technische Architektur & Kernel-Modell
  • Versionen, Updates & Lifecycle
  • Lizenzierungsmodelle (OEM, Volumen, ESU)
  • Globale Marktverbreitung & Statistiken
  • Bedeutung in der Softwareentwicklung
  • Bonus: Erläuterung des Begriffs „Microslop“
Made byBobr AI

Historie: Von DOS zur Plattform

  • 1985: Windows 1.0: Grafischer Aufsatz für MS-DOS, kooperatives Multitasking.
  • Windows 9x Linie: Hybrid-Kernel, Fokus auf Kompatibilität und Heimanwender.
  • Windows NT (New Technology): 1993 eingeführter, vollständig 32-Bit-basierter Kernel für professionelle Nutzung.
  • Zusammenführung: Windows XP vereinte die Stabilität von NT mit der Multimedia-Fähigkeit von 9x.
Windows 1.0 screenshot or generic retro computer interface 1980s style
Made byBobr AI

Wichtige Meilensteine

Windows NT 4.0
Basis der modernen Architektur, Trennung von User/Kernel Mode.
Windows XP & 7
Massenmarkt-Durchdringung, Etablierung im Enterprise-Umfeld.
Windows 10
„Windows as a Service“ (WaaS), kontinuierliche Feature-Updates.
Windows 11
Modernisierung der UI, TPM 2.0 Zwang, Fokus auf Sicherheit.
Made byBobr AI

Architektur: User Mode vs. Kernel Mode

  • Kernel Mode (Ring 0): Voller Zugriff auf Hardware und Systemspeicher. Fehler hier führen zum Systemabsturz (BSOD). Beinhaltet HAL, Treiber, Kernel.
  • User Mode (Ring 3): Eingeschränkter Zugriff. Anwendungssoftware läuft hier isoliert. Zugriff auf Hardware nur über APIs (System Calls).
  • Sicherheit: Strikte Trennung verhindert, dass Apps das System destabilisieren.
diagram showing user mode versus kernel mode architecture operation system layers
Made byBobr AI

Zentrale Systemkomponenten

NT Kernel & Executive
Prozessmanagement, I/O Management, Speicherverwaltung.
HAL (Hardware Abstraction Layer)
Schnittstelle zwischen physischer Hardware und Kernel.
Windows Registry
Hierarchische Datenbank für Konfigurationseinstellungen.
Dateisystem (NTFS)
Journaling, ACL-Berechtigungen, Encryption (EFS).
Made byBobr AI

Entwickler-Relevante Komponenten

Windows Subsystem for Linux (WSL 2):
Ermöglicht das Ausführen einer echten Linux-Kernel-Instanz direkt unter Windows. Essenziell für Web-Entwicklung, Docker-Container und Cross-Platform-Workflows ohne Dual-Boot.
Entwicklungsumgebung:
Tiefe Integration von IDEs wie Visual Studio und VS Code. Umfassende API-Unterstützung (Win32, .NET, UWP/WinUI 3).
Windows Subsystem for Linux terminal screen screenshot
Made byBobr AI

Versionen und Updates: 10 vs. 11

Windows 10

  • Support-Ende: Oktober 2025.
  • Sehr hohe Verbreitung im Unternehmensumfeld.
  • Stabiles UI-Design (Kacheln).
  • Reguläre Sicherheitsupdates bis EOL.

Windows 11

  • Aktueller Standard (Feature Updates z.B. 24H2).
  • Hardware-Anforderungen: TPM 2.0, Secure Boot.
  • Neues UI-Design (Zentrierte Taskleiste).
  • Optimiert für hybrides Arbeiten und Sicherheit.

Das 'Modern Lifecycle Policy' Modell garantiert Support, solange die aktuellste Feature-Update-Version installiert ist.

Made byBobr AI

Update-Modell und Servicing

  • Patch Tuesday: Monatlicher Zyklus für kumulative Sicherheits- und Qualitätsupdates (jeden 2. Dienstag).
  • Feature Updates: Jährliche große Funktionserweiterungen (z.B. 24H2). Installation ist optionaler steuerbar.
  • Enterprise Management: Steuerung über WSUS (Windows Server Update Services) oder Intune. Unternehmen testen Patches in 'Rings' (Pilot -> Produktion).
abstract icon graphic representing software update sync arrows blue clean style
Made byBobr AI

Preis- und Lizenzierungsmodell

  • OEM (Original Equipment Manufacturer): An Hardware gebunden, vorinstalliert, nicht übertragbar. Günstigste Variante.
  • Retail (FPP): Übertragbare Volllizenz, teurer, Support durch Microsoft.
  • Volume Licensing: Für Unternehmen (Open License, Enterprise Agreement). Ermöglicht Image-Deployment und KMS/MAK Aktivierung.
  • ESU (Extended Security Updates): Kostenpflichtige Verlängerung für Sicherheitsupdates nach End-of-Life (relevant für Windows 10 ab Okt 2025).
Windows holographic sticker on laptop or retail box
Made byBobr AI

Globale Marktverbreitung

Marktanteile Desktop-Betriebssysteme (Windows only) - Juli 2025. Windows 11 hat Windows 10 erstmals überholt.

Chart
Made byBobr AI

Windows in der Anwendungsentwicklung

  • Dominanz am Arbeitsplatz: Firmensoftware wird primär für Windows entwickelt (B2B).
  • Ecosystem: Visual Studio, .NET Framework / .NET Core bieten mächtige Tools.
  • Hybrid-Development: Durch WSL können Linux-Server-Anwendungen nativ auf Windows entwickelt werden.
  • Legacy-Support: Enorme Kompatibilität sichert die Lauffähigkeit von Jahrzehnte alter Industriesoftware.
software developer workspace with multiple monitors running visual studio
Made byBobr AI

Gaming, Industrie & DirectX

  • DirectX: Standard-API für Multimedia und Grafik. Hauptgrund für Windows-Dominanz im PC-Gaming.
  • Vulkan & OpenGL: Werden unterstützt, aber DirectX ist in vielen Engines (Unreal, Unity) tief integriert.
  • Industrie: Viele Maschinensteuerungen (HMI, SCADA) basieren auf Windows aufgrund spezieller Treiber und Langzeit-Support.
DirectX logo
Made byBobr AI

Bonus: Der Begriff „Microslop“

  • Herkunft: Internet-Slang, Kofferwort aus „Microsoft“ und „Slop“ (dt. Matsch/Abfall, Internetbegriff für minderwertigen, massenproduzierten Content).
  • Kontext: Wird oft satirisch oder kritisch verwendet, wenn Nutzer unzufrieden mit Features sind (z.B. Werbung im Startmenü, vorinstallierte Bloatware oder erzwungene KI-Integration).
  • Relevanz: Zeigt die Diskrepanz zwischen Unternehmensstrategie (Monetarisierung) und User Experience. Kein technischer Fachbegriff!
glitch art abstract style digital noise aesthetic without text
Made byBobr AI

Aufgabenverteilung im Team

  • Person A: Historie, Meilensteine & Versionen (Windows 1.0 - 11)
  • Person B: Technische Architektur & Systemkomponenten
  • Person C: Lizenzierung, Marktanteile & Statistiken
  • Person D: Entwickler-Perspektive, Gaming & Bonus-Thema
Made byBobr AI

Fazit

Microsoft Windows bleibt trotz starker mobiler Konkurrenz (Android/iOS) das Rückgrat der Business-IT und Softwareentwicklung.

Die Transformation zu 'Windows as a Service' und die Integration von Linux (WSL) sichern die Zukunftsfähigkeit der Plattform.
Vielen Dank für die Aufmerksamkeit.
Made byBobr AI
Bobr AI

DESIGNER-MADE
PRESENTATION,
GENERATED FROM
YOUR PROMPT

Create your own professional slide deck with real images, data charts, and unique design in under a minute.

Generate For Free

Windows: Architektur, Historie & Softwareentwicklung

Detaillierte Analyse von Microsoft Windows: Von NT-Architektur und Kernel-Modus bis hin zu WSL, Lizenzierung und Marktanteilen für Fachinformatiker.

Microsoft Windows

Historie, Architektur, Marktverbreitung und Bedeutung für die Anwendungsentwicklung

Fachinformatiker Anwendungsentwicklung | Schuljahr 2025/2026

Agenda

<ul><li>Historie und Entwicklungslinien</li><li>Technische Architektur & Kernel-Modell</li><li>Versionen, Updates & Lifecycle</li><li>Lizenzierungsmodelle (OEM, Volumen, ESU)</li><li>Globale Marktverbreitung & Statistiken</li><li>Bedeutung in der Softwareentwicklung</li><li>Bonus: Erläuterung des Begriffs „Microslop“</li></ul>

Historie: Von DOS zur Plattform

<ul><li><strong>1985: Windows 1.0:</strong> Grafischer Aufsatz für MS-DOS, kooperatives Multitasking.</li><li><strong>Windows 9x Linie:</strong> Hybrid-Kernel, Fokus auf Kompatibilität und Heimanwender.</li><li><strong>Windows NT (New Technology):</strong> 1993 eingeführter, vollständig 32-Bit-basierter Kernel für professionelle Nutzung.</li><li><strong>Zusammenführung:</strong> Windows XP vereinte die Stabilität von NT mit der Multimedia-Fähigkeit von 9x.</li></ul>

Wichtige Meilensteine

<strong>Windows NT 4.0</strong><br>Basis der modernen Architektur, Trennung von User/Kernel Mode.

<strong>Windows XP & 7</strong><br>Massenmarkt-Durchdringung, Etablierung im Enterprise-Umfeld.

<strong>Windows 10</strong><br>„Windows as a Service“ (WaaS), kontinuierliche Feature-Updates.

<strong>Windows 11</strong><br>Modernisierung der UI, TPM 2.0 Zwang, Fokus auf Sicherheit.

Architektur: User Mode vs. Kernel Mode

<ul><li><strong>Kernel Mode (Ring 0):</strong> Voller Zugriff auf Hardware und Systemspeicher. Fehler hier führen zum Systemabsturz (BSOD). Beinhaltet HAL, Treiber, Kernel.</li><li><strong>User Mode (Ring 3):</strong> Eingeschränkter Zugriff. Anwendungssoftware läuft hier isoliert. Zugriff auf Hardware nur über APIs (System Calls).</li><li><strong>Sicherheit:</strong> Strikte Trennung verhindert, dass Apps das System destabilisieren.</li></ul>

Zentrale Systemkomponenten

<strong>NT Kernel & Executive</strong><br>Prozessmanagement, I/O Management, Speicherverwaltung.

<strong>HAL (Hardware Abstraction Layer)</strong><br>Schnittstelle zwischen physischer Hardware und Kernel.

<strong>Windows Registry</strong><br>Hierarchische Datenbank für Konfigurationseinstellungen.

<strong>Dateisystem (NTFS)</strong><br>Journaling, ACL-Berechtigungen, Encryption (EFS).

Entwickler-Relevante Komponenten

<strong>Windows Subsystem for Linux (WSL 2):</strong><br>Ermöglicht das Ausführen einer echten Linux-Kernel-Instanz direkt unter Windows. Essenziell für Web-Entwicklung, Docker-Container und Cross-Platform-Workflows ohne Dual-Boot.

<strong>Entwicklungsumgebung:</strong><br>Tiefe Integration von IDEs wie Visual Studio und VS Code. Umfassende API-Unterstützung (Win32, .NET, UWP/WinUI 3).

Versionen und Updates: 10 vs. 11

<h3 style='color:#0078D7;'>Windows 10</h3><ul><li>Support-Ende: Oktober 2025.</li><li>Sehr hohe Verbreitung im Unternehmensumfeld.</li><li>Stabiles UI-Design (Kacheln).</li><li>Reguläre Sicherheitsupdates bis EOL.</li></ul>

<h3 style='color:#0078D7;'>Windows 11</h3><ul><li>Aktueller Standard (Feature Updates z.B. 24H2).</li><li>Hardware-Anforderungen: TPM 2.0, Secure Boot.</li><li>Neues UI-Design (Zentrierte Taskleiste).</li><li>Optimiert für hybrides Arbeiten und Sicherheit.</li></ul>

Das 'Modern Lifecycle Policy' Modell garantiert Support, solange die aktuellste Feature-Update-Version installiert ist.

Update-Modell und Servicing

<ul><li><strong>Patch Tuesday:</strong> Monatlicher Zyklus für kumulative Sicherheits- und Qualitätsupdates (jeden 2. Dienstag).</li><li><strong>Feature Updates:</strong> Jährliche große Funktionserweiterungen (z.B. 24H2). Installation ist optionaler steuerbar.</li><li><strong>Enterprise Management:</strong> Steuerung über WSUS (Windows Server Update Services) oder Intune. Unternehmen testen Patches in 'Rings' (Pilot -> Produktion).</li></ul>

Preis- und Lizenzierungsmodell

<ul><li><strong>OEM (Original Equipment Manufacturer):</strong> An Hardware gebunden, vorinstalliert, nicht übertragbar. Günstigste Variante.</li><li><strong>Retail (FPP):</strong> Übertragbare Volllizenz, teurer, Support durch Microsoft.</li><li><strong>Volume Licensing:</strong> Für Unternehmen (Open License, Enterprise Agreement). Ermöglicht Image-Deployment und KMS/MAK Aktivierung.</li><li><strong>ESU (Extended Security Updates):</strong> Kostenpflichtige Verlängerung für Sicherheitsupdates nach End-of-Life (relevant für Windows 10 ab Okt 2025).</li></ul>

Globale Marktverbreitung

Marktanteile Desktop-Betriebssysteme (Windows only) - Juli 2025. Windows 11 hat Windows 10 erstmals überholt.

Windows in der Anwendungsentwicklung

<ul><li><strong>Dominanz am Arbeitsplatz:</strong> Firmensoftware wird primär für Windows entwickelt (B2B).</li><li><strong>Ecosystem:</strong> Visual Studio, .NET Framework / .NET Core bieten mächtige Tools.</li><li><strong>Hybrid-Development:</strong> Durch WSL können Linux-Server-Anwendungen nativ auf Windows entwickelt werden.</li><li><strong>Legacy-Support:</strong> Enorme Kompatibilität sichert die Lauffähigkeit von Jahrzehnte alter Industriesoftware.</li></ul>

Gaming, Industrie & DirectX

<ul><li><strong>DirectX:</strong> Standard-API für Multimedia und Grafik. Hauptgrund für Windows-Dominanz im PC-Gaming.</li><li><strong>Vulkan & OpenGL:</strong> Werden unterstützt, aber DirectX ist in vielen Engines (Unreal, Unity) tief integriert.</li><li><strong>Industrie:</strong> Viele Maschinensteuerungen (HMI, SCADA) basieren auf Windows aufgrund spezieller Treiber und Langzeit-Support.</li></ul>

Bonus: Der Begriff „Microslop“

<ul><li><strong>Herkunft:</strong> Internet-Slang, Kofferwort aus „Microsoft“ und „Slop“ (dt. Matsch/Abfall, Internetbegriff für minderwertigen, massenproduzierten Content).</li><li><strong>Kontext:</strong> Wird oft satirisch oder kritisch verwendet, wenn Nutzer unzufrieden mit Features sind (z.B. Werbung im Startmenü, vorinstallierte Bloatware oder erzwungene KI-Integration).</li><li><strong>Relevanz:</strong> Zeigt die Diskrepanz zwischen Unternehmensstrategie (Monetarisierung) und User Experience. Kein technischer Fachbegriff!</li></ul>

Aufgabenverteilung im Team

<ul><li><strong>Person A:</strong> Historie, Meilensteine & Versionen (Windows 1.0 - 11)</li><li><strong>Person B:</strong> Technische Architektur & Systemkomponenten</li><li><strong>Person C:</strong> Lizenzierung, Marktanteile & Statistiken</li><li><strong>Person D:</strong> Entwickler-Perspektive, Gaming & Bonus-Thema</li></ul>

Fazit

Microsoft Windows bleibt trotz starker mobiler Konkurrenz (Android/iOS) das <strong>Rückgrat der Business-IT und Softwareentwicklung</strong>. <br><br>Die Transformation zu 'Windows as a Service' und die Integration von Linux (WSL) sichern die Zukunftsfähigkeit der Plattform.

Vielen Dank für die Aufmerksamkeit.

  • windows
  • betriebssysteme
  • softwareentwicklung
  • informatik-studium
  • kernel-architektur
  • wsl2
  • it-infrastruktur
  • microsoft